Output 25d1a00091a7e213a4eca3ebc9491705d9e638b7a6a2a980a74d48959dfd2ddd:3

value
53163633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a627019e88f04637dfd40a89e3cc62abea364e0e OP_EQUAL
address
3GqYpbSUxYskvy5oACABKjFEH5GQucwxpP
transaction
25d1a00091a7e213a4eca3ebc9491705d9e638b7a6a2a980a74d48959dfd2ddd
spent
true